    How can I open an xls file in office powerpoint?

    I have Office Powerpoint on my Windows xp. When I try to open a xls file, it
    says it needs to know what program wrote it to open it. What can I do?

    How can I open an xls file in office powerpoint?

    Do you have Excel installed on the computer where you are
    trying to open this file? You would need that application.

    Re: How can I open an xls file in office powerpoint?

    If you can get the originator of the Excel file to save the workbook as
    a web page you can open that in PowerPoint.

    Re: How can I open an xls file in office powerpoint?

    Maybe you could use the free excel viewer from Microsoft.

    http://www.microsoft.com/downloads/d...7-75edbd03aaf0
    (one line in your browser)
    (10 meg about)

    or use OpenOffice
    http://www.openoffice.org (65 meg about)
